Transaction ac109f476ee2da74ad0180dff0a58d3b89a9ed8d756d4d729b46e46827f705fc

1 Input
2 Outputs
  • ac109f476ee2da74ad0180dff0a58d3b89a9ed8d756d4d729b46e46827f705fc:0
  • value  12849060
    address  36ShaFhcPsGjmb4XqaroJjYWCiRxovk67B
  • ac109f476ee2da74ad0180dff0a58d3b89a9ed8d756d4d729b46e46827f705fc:1
  • value  1823381
    address  114mdECs6Z6NLuHG2R8ESbEwy1paFtFaLu